  • Patent number: 10544691
    Abstract: A staking tool assembly for staking a pin coupling a turbine blade with a turbine disk is disclosed. The staking tool assembly includes a guide block configured to be positioned between a space defined between two consecutive turbine blades mounted on the turbine disk. The guide block includes a bottom surface configured to abut a blade root of the turbine blade. The guide block further includes a groove extending from the bottom surface through the guide block. The groove is configured to receive a portion of the pin extending outwardly from the blade root to facilitate a staking of the pin.
